Can hoarding cleanup services work in apartments and rental properties?
Yes, hoarding cleanup services work in apartments and rental properties, helping tenants restore their living spaces to meet lease agreements and health codes. Landlords may require professional cleanup if a rental unit becomes uninhabitable due to hoarding. Cleanup teams ensure the property is decluttered, cleaned, and sanitized to prevent eviction or legal disputes. If needed, they can also document the cleanup process for landlords and property managers.
